Hike #3, Feather Falls, Oroville

Today we did our longest hike yet!  We hiked to Feather Falls, in Oroville.  It's a moderate 9 mile round trip hike, with a big big payoff!!!!  Feather Falls is the 8th highest waterfall in the US and it was a gusher!  The weather was a nice cool 65 degrees and a little breezy.  It made for nice mist at the end of the trail.  Janise is the only one who'd done this hike previously so it was a treat for the rest of the family to see it.  Waterfalls are a big plus for motivating tired hikers.

Hike #2, Stebbins Cold Canyon Trail, Lake Berryessa

Today we hiked a 4 mile loop trail overlooking Lake Berryessa.  The day was quite a bit warmer than last week and the first mile was quite a strenuous (and exposed) climb to the ridge.   Bits of it really reminded us of the Olomana hike in Oahu.  Along the ridge, portions of the trail were 100% boulder.  I've never hiked anything quite like it.  The last 2 miles were all downhill and shady.  Lovely!  The trail ended at a stream, where Sydney and Holly waded.  I was really glad for that because poison oak was  EVERYWHERE.

Hike #1

This is one that started it all!  Today we hiked the Stevens Trail in Auburn.  It's a gentle 4 miles downhill to the American River and a not so gentle hike back up.  We had perfect weather (nice and cool) and we were all appropriately tired at the end.
